his circuit uses only one octal D-
type latch, IC 74LS373, and some
associated circuitry to control
eight different gadgets. To control more
devices, identical circuits, in multiples,
can be used. The circuit incorporates
the following features:
(a) Individual ‘on/off’ control for all
channels.
(b) Emergency ‘off’ control for all
channels.
(c) Immediate ‘on’ control for all
channels.
(d) LED indication for ‘on’ channels.
(e) Optional push-to-on buttons or
tactile switches.
When one presses the ‘on’ switch
(S1) of channel 1, a logic low is applied
to data input pin D0. The same level
appears on the data output pin Q0,
because latch-enable pin LE (active
high) is connected to Vcc, and the out-
put-enable OE (active low) is pulled
down using resistor R9. At the same
time, Q0 output is fed back to D0
input, which thus keeps the common

junction of D0 and Q0 (marked ‘A’ in
the figures) at low level, even after
releasing on switch S1. This low level
is applied to the base of transistor
T1 through diode D9 to turn it on,
and RL1 is activated. LED1 also
glows to indicate that channel 1 is
on. The other channels can also be
switched on, as desired, in a similar
manner.
To switch off channel 1, off switch
S9 of channel 1 is pressed to apply
logic high to point A. Because
